  • In the middle school years, Lakeview Middle's curriculum focuses on helping students to become increasingly independent learners and preparing them to succeed in high school and beyond.

  • In Grades 6–8, students deepen their knowledge and skills in four core subjects: History & Geography, Language Arts, Math, and Science.  Lakeview Middle works to help their students:

    • Develop independent learning strategies and study skills.
    • Deepen their reading comprehension and writing skills.
    • Learn advanced math concepts in preparation for higher level math courses.

    Students also have the opportunity to participate in several connections courses:

    • Art
    • Band
    • Computer Science / Business Education
    • Chorus
    • Health
    • Family and Consumer Science
    • Physical Education
  • Our framework for learning works to keep middle schoolers interested and engaged with:

    • Projects that apply learning to the real world and are tailored to their interests.
    • Activities that encourage them to think for themselves as they apply what they learn in meaningful ways.
    • Assessments where they use their learning to demonstrate mastery of each concept.
